Please forgive my ignorance...
as, I am sure most of you will be shaking your heads in disbelief when I ask this question, but, I am completely MIDI ignorant.
Due to a recent local increase in creating "beats", I have been forced to consider purchasing some vitual instruments. My question is, if I purchase MOTU's Ethno Instrument and say an M-Audio Keystation Pro88, am I able to "play" the instruments as if it were one of a keyboard's voices. Also, would I be able to control other virtual instruments like drum packages and piano packages, etc.? Lastly, would I be able to compose loops in my current recording software(cep2) or do I need software specifically designed for "beats" and loops and import the files to my recording software? I really appreciate patience with your responses, I am sure this is probably kindergarten level midi questions.

I second the first two 'yeses' above.
And I do know about looping software. Download Reaper here --- LINK. It's a powerful but cheap midi/audio shareware sequencer that is getting rave reviews all over this board. It's $40 to buy a license, but you have 30 days to test it out on your own system before forking over any cash. It will host MOTU's Ethno Instrument and allow you to work with it as if it were built in to your controller. .
